Nine Inch Nails

Halo Thirty One

2017-11-16

I would rate this a 6 out of 10. As always they never disappoint when it comes to producing an album, and this one is no different. It has the weird sound qualities you would look for and accept as well, much like some of their traditional music. Didn't do anything for me, but I could see a message being delivered.

review by Matt
